Job Description

The New York City Department of Education (NYC DOE) seeks a qualified contractor to provide comprehensive project management, business analysis, application support, testing, training, data management, business intelligence, and reporting services for its Special Education systems. The project supports the implementation and ongoing enhancement of the ATLAS platform, modernization of Special Education applications, development of regulatory and operational reports, maintenance of enterprise data repositories, user training, and continuous operational support. The Contractor will provide a multidisciplinary team of technical and functional experts to ensure the successful delivery of system enhancements, data integration, reporting solutions, quality assurance, and end-user support while maintaining compliance with federal, state, and NYC DOE Special Education requirements.
The IT Manager – Data Manager is responsible for leading enterprise data management and architecture activities supporting the NYC DOE Special Education Systems and Reporting project. The role performs complex data analysis, develops enterprise data models, designs and implements database solutions, and supports data integration across multiple applications. The Data Manager ensures data integrity, consistency, and accessibility while enabling business intelligence, analytics, regulatory reporting, and operational reporting across the Special Education environment.

R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Lead enterprise data management, governance, and data architecture initiatives.
  • Perform complex data analysis and data profiling to support business and reporting requirements.
  • Develop conceptual, logical, and physical data models.
  • Design and implement database structures that improve data integrity and performance.
  • Lead complex data mapping and data integration efforts across multiple enterprise applications.
  • Develop and maintain enterprise data dictionaries, metadata, and data lineage documentation.
  • Support data warehouse and data mart design and maintenance.
  • Collaborate with Business Analysts, ETL Developers, BI Developers, and application teams to ensure data consistency.
  • Develop SQL queries, stored procedures, and scripts to support reporting and analytics.
  • Support the development of regulatory, operational, and executive reporting solutions.
  • Identify and resolve data quality issues through validation and reconciliation activities.
  • Produce technical documentation, database design documents, and data architecture artifacts.
  • Provide technical leadership and recommendations for data management best practices.

REQUIRED SKILLS & QUALIFICATIONS
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Data Management, or a related discipline.
  • Minimum of 8 years of experience in data management, database design, or data architecture.
  • Demonstrated experience performing complex data analysis and enterprise data modeling.
  • Experience designing and supporting enterprise data warehouses and data marts.
  • Strong knowledge of relational database design principles and data normalization.
  • Advanced proficiency with Microsoft SQL Server, including T-SQL, stored procedures, views, and query optimization.
  • Experience developing data models and process diagrams using Microsoft Visio
  • Experience with Business Intelligence tools (e.g., Power BI, SSRS, or comparable BI platforms).
  • Experience supporting enterprise reporting, analytics, and regulatory reporting initiatives.
  • Strong understanding of ETL processes, data integration, and data mapping techniques.
  • Excellent analytical, documentation, communication, and problem-solving skills.
  • Experience working on large-scale government or public-sector technology projects is preferred.
  • Experience supporting education, Special Education, or student information systems is highly desirable.
TECHNOLOGIES
  • Microsoft SQL Server, Microsoft Visio
  • Business Intelligence Tools (Power BI, SSRS, or equivalent)
  • T-SQL, Data Warehousing, Data Modeling, ETL/Data Integration
